    There are few things more disappointing than a place with a legendary reputation that serves a breakfast you wouldn't wish on someone you actually like. Jax at the Tracks has the kind of pedigree that makes you walk in expecting something memorable. Featured on *Diners, Drive-Ins and Dives*, I figured I was in for honest, comforting food done right. Instead, I spent over an hour waiting for a meal that looked tired before it even hit the table. The English muffins were stale. The jelly had dried out like it had been sitting on the table since breakfast yesterday. The eggs were cooked so poorly you'd think nobody in the kitchen had ever cracked one before. The corned beef hash was especially offensive—not just because it tasted bad, but because it looked absolutely nothing like the picture that sold it. It was an unappetizing mess. Then came the service—or rather, the lack of it. Once the food was dropped off, we may as well have become invisible. No one came back to ask how things were. No refill, no "Is everything okay?", nothing. By the time someone finally addressed the problem, the experience was already beyond saving. To their credit, they removed my entrée from the bill. That was the right thing to do. But it doesn't give me back the hour I spent waiting for a breakfast that wasn't worth eating. Ironically, the best thing that crossed our table was the Bloody Mary. It was well made, balanced, and the only item that lived up to any expectation. Restaurants earn reputations one plate at a time, and they lose them the same way. Hype can get people through the door once. Good food and attentive service are what bring them back. Unfortunately, Jax at the Tracks delivered neither. I came expecting a destination-worthy breakfast. I left wishing I'd stopped at a diner with no TV fame at all.
